This website is NOT safe. It uses a fake “Human Verification” process that is actually part of a known phishing/malware attack called a ClickFix attack. It tries to impersonate legitimate services like Cloudflare and may instruct you to open Windows Run, PowerShell, or your terminal and paste commands. This is extremely dangerous. No real security service will EVER ask you to run commands on your own computer to verify you’re human. If you see this: Do NOT follow the instructions Do NOT paste anything into your system Close the site immediately This is a well-known tactic used to install malware and steal information.
